일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| |||||
3 | 4 | 5 | 6 | 7 | 8 | 9 |
10 | 11 | 12 | 13 | 14 | 15 | 16 |
17 | 18 | 19 | 20 | 21 | 22 | 23 |
24 | 25 | 26 | 27 | 28 | 29 | 30 |
- tm
- 개발
- ABAP
- 백준 알고리즘
- 자바
- sap
- Algorithm
- BOPF
- ui5
- visual studio code
- SAP 번역
- BOBF
- FPM
- udemy
- Fiori
- html
- S/4HANA
- 자바 클래스
- java
- mac
- module
- 클래스
- python
- Deep Learning
- BTP
- 파이썬
- 맥북
- Eclipse
- 알고리즘
- 이클립스
- Today
- Total
목록Fiori (10)
z2soo's Blog
SAP 시스템에서는 다양한 아이콘을 제공하고 있고, 프로그램은 물론 다양한 시스템 설정에서 아이콘을 활용한다. 아이콘 이름을 입력하기도 하지만 주로 아이디를 사용하니 그 정보를 확인하는 방법을 알아보자. 1. ICON 이미지 확인 T-Code : SE11 Database Table : ICON ICON 테이블에서 원하는 ICON의 이미지 보고 이름을 확인한다. 여기에서는 SAP Logo 이미지를 찾아보았다. 찾은 아이콘의 이름을 확인해주자. 2. ICON 아이디 확인 T-Code : SE11 Type Group : ICON ABAP Dictionary에서 Type Group을 Icon 으로 입력하고 실행해본다. 아래와 같이 모든 아이콘들의 정보가 나오는데, 아이콘의 이름과 아이디를 확인할 수 있다. 이 ..
ABAP Source Code 다운로드 프로그램 ABAP 프로그램 또는 펑션을 구현하다 보면 해당 source code를 따로 저장해둬야 하는 경우가 있다. 주로 반복적으로 동일한 프로그램, 펑션을 구현하다 보니 개인적으로 source를 가지고 사용하기 위한 경우가 대부분이지만... 이런 경우 프로그램을 통해 txt 파일 또는 html 파일 형태로 source code를 다운받을 수 있는 코드가 있다. E.G.Mellodew 라는 사람이 만든 Mass dowmload 프로그램으로 해당 포스팅 맨 마지막에 있는 텍스트 파일을 다운받아 그대로 붙여넣어 프로그램을 생성 및 실행하면 된다. 한글 깨짐 현상 다운로드 받았을 때, 한글 깨짐 현상이 발생하는 경우가 있다. 이 경우 아래 이미지와 같이 코드 중 아래의..
1. Pre-steps 프로젝트에 view 및 view에 data binding이 완료된 상태에서 진행하도록 하자. 이전 스텝들은 아래 글을 참고하면 된다. [Fiori] 프로젝트 생성 1. Work Space 생성 Fiori 프로젝트 생성이라고는 하지만, 하나의 작업 단위를 생성하는 과정으로 이해하면 될 것 같다. SAP Cloud Cockpit 사이트에서 Neo 평가판 > 서비스 부분으로 들어가면 다음과 같이 z2soo.tistory.com [Fiori] View 생성 1. 프로젝트 생성 Fiori 실습을 진행하기 위한 환경이자 하나의 작업 단위인 프로젝트를 우선 생성해준다. 이전 글을 참조하도록 하자. [Fiori] 프로젝트 생성 1. Work Space 생성 Fiori 프로젝트 생성이 z2soo...
Data Model 연결 선행 작업으로 프로젝트에 데이터 모델을 연결해주자. 그 후, 프로젝트 내에서 뷰, 리스트 등의 기능에 데이터를 연결해보도록 한다. [Fiori] Data Model 추가 프로젝트 생성 Fiori 실습을 진행하기 위한 환경이자 하나의 작업 단위인 프로젝트와 그 안에 View를 우선 생성해준다. 이전 글을 참조하도록 하자. [Fiori] 프로젝트 생성 1. Work Space 생성 Fiori 프로 z2soo.tistory.com 1. Data Binding Data bind는 프로젝트의 다양한 기능에 가능하다. 프로젝트에서 여러 화면을 생성하다 보면 List control을 가장 많이 사용하게 될 것이고, 이번 포스팅에서도 List control에 data를 bind 해보자. 우선 ..
프로젝트 생성 Fiori 실습을 진행하기 위한 환경이자 하나의 작업 단위인 프로젝트와 그 안에 View를 우선 생성해준다. 이전 글을 참조하도록 하자. [Fiori] 프로젝트 생성 1. Work Space 생성 Fiori 프로젝트 생성이라고는 하지만, 하나의 작업 단위를 생성하는 과정으로 이해하면 될 것 같다. SAP Cloud Cockpit 사이트에서 Neo 평가판 > 서비스 부분으로 들어가면 다음과 같이 z2soo.tistory.com 1. URL 테이터 추가 manifest.json 파일의 data source 탭으로 이동해서 추가 버튼을 눌러주면 팝업 창이 뜬다. 지금은 URL 주소를 활용해서 데이터를 가져올 것이기 때문에 Service URL을 선택해주고, Create a new data sou..
1. 프로젝트 및 View 생성 Fiori 실습을 진행하기 위한 환경이자 하나의 작업 단위인 프로젝트와 그 안에 View를 우선 생성해준다. 이전 글을 참조하도록 하자. [Fiori] View 생성 1. 프로젝트 생성 Fiori 실습을 진행하기 위한 환경이자 하나의 작업 단위인 프로젝트를 우선 생성해준다. 이전 글을 참조하도록 하자. [Fiori] 프로젝트 생성 1. Work Space 생성 Fiori 프로젝트 생성이 z2soo.tistory.com 2. Label 생성 생성된 View를 가지고 간단한 기능만 구현해보자. 우선 편집하려는 View 파일을 우클릭하여 Open Layout Editor로 열어준다. 그러면 코드가 아닌 툴바로 작업 가능한 화면이 나온다. Layout Editor로 View를 열..
Key point SQL Editor T-Code : DB02 S/4HANA SQL Editor SAP ECC 에서는 Oracle DB를 사용하였지만, S/4HANA로 전환되면서 HANA DB를 사용하게 되었다. 속도, ABAP Query 간결화 등 변화 사항이 있고 장점이 존재하지만, 기존에 Oracle query를 사용하는 기능 일부를 사용할 수 없게 된 단점(?)도 있다. CBO 프로그램 중 Oracle query를 통해 데이터를 조회하는 프로그램이 있었는데, 해당 프로그램 또한 S/4HANA로 conversion 작업을 진행하면서 사용 불가 상태가 됬다. 이런 경우 사용 가능한 transaction 프로그램이 있다. T-Code : DB02 해당 transaction을 실행하여 좌측의 SQL Ed..
1. 프로젝트 생성 Fiori 실습을 진행하기 위한 환경이자 하나의 작업 단위인 프로젝트를 우선 생성해준다. 이전 글을 참조하도록 하자. [Fiori] 프로젝트 생성 1. Work Space 생성 Fiori 프로젝트 생성이라고는 하지만, 하나의 작업 단위를 생성하는 과정으로 이해하면 될 것 같다. SAP Cloud Cockpit 사이트에서 Neo 평가판 > 서비스 부분으로 들어가면 다음과 같이 z2soo.tistory.com 2. View 생성 생성된 프로젝트 좌특 툴바를 보면 자동적으로 생성된 파일들을 확인할 수 있다. 이 중, view 부분은 사용자에게 보여지는 부분으로써 view 폴더 하위에 존재하는 view 파일과 동일한 명으로 controller 폴더 하위에도 자동적으로 생성되어 존재하게 된다...
1. Work Space 생성 Fiori 프로젝트 생성이라고는 하지만, 하나의 작업 단위를 생성하는 과정으로 이해하면 될 것 같다. SAP Cloud Cockpit 사이트에서 Neo 평가판 > 서비스 부분으로 들어가면 다음과 같이 제공하는 서비스에 대해 확인할 수 있다. 이 중 SAP Web IDE를 클릭해서 들어간다. 하단에 위치한 서비스로 이동을 누른다. 아래와 같은 화면이 나온다. 이 때, 상단 우측의 Work Space를 통해 Work Space Manage 화면으로 이동할 수 있다. 새로운 work space를 생성할 수 있으며, 기존 work space에 대한 관리(수정, 삭제) 또한 가능하다. 우선 앞으로 사용할 work space를 z2soo 라는 이름으로 생성해주었다. 2. 프로젝트 생성..
1. 교육과정 프로젝트 과제 개요 클라우드 기반 IT 기초 GCP, SCP 개요 및 활용 SAP 모듈 (S/4HANA 전반적 모듈, SD, MM 중심) SAP ABAP (TAW10, 12) Javascript 기초 UI5/Fiori (UX400/UX410) Visualization/Report (태블로 활용) 구현 프로젝트 (ABAP, on-prem/UI5, Fiori, SCP, ELT, GCP) 2. 주요 상세 과정 IT 기초 Data Abstraction (Variables, Data Types) State & Statement (Declaration, Assignment) Flow Control (Condition, Loop, Operation) Proces Abstraction (Function,..